Subject: [PATCH v4 00/14] sc5xx Environment Cleanup and Fixes
Date: Fri, 10 Apr 2026 09:57:55 -0400 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<cover.1775829166.git.jcethrid@gmail.com> (raw)
This series performs a general cleanup of the default U-boot environment
for sc5xx boards, stemming from the decision to no longer store the
environment in the SPI flash. The environments for each board have been
edited to contain the minimum number of commands needed for all supported
boot modes to avoid confusion, and the default boot command synced to spi
for all boards that support it. The filesystem for the SPI flash has also
been changed from jffs2 to ubifs.
A bug with the Ethernet reset line on the sc594 has been fixed, and the
sc573 has been renamed from the EZKIT to the EZLITE to match the name of the
publically available board. EZKIT was only used internally before release.
Preliminary binman support for sc5xx boards has been removed as it was unused
and full support never added.
